Welcome Dr. Erik P. Goldschmidt

Hurley Counseling is pleased to announce that Erik P. Goldschmidt, Ph.D. is joining our practice on November 4, 2019. Dr. Goldschmidt received his doctorate in Counseling Psychology from Boston College. He has clinical experience involving psychological testing, diagnostic assessment, and psychotherapy with adolescents, adults, and families. Most recently, he is Director of the Foley Community Service Center at Spring Hill College and a consulting psychologist for L’Arche Mobile.

Dr. Goldschmidt completed part of his training at The Walker Home and School in Massachusetts which specializes in children with severe behavioral disabilities. He completed a clinical internship at Harvard Medical School and he was a postdoctoral behavioral health fellow with Harvard Vanguard Medical Associates. Dr. Goldschmidt was a presenter at the annual meeting of the American Psychological Association in 2005, 2007, and 2009.

His dedication to the mental health field and community service makes him an ideal fit for Hurley Counseling. For more information on his experience, credentials, and publications, please visit Hurley-counseling.com.

Dr. Goldschmidt will be seeing adolescents, adults, and families in both our Fairhope and Mobile offices. He is in the process of obtaining Blue Cross and Blue Shield approval. He currently does not accept insurance.
